The Invasion of Fruit Flies

We spent last week in Pineville visiting Mems and Pops! We had other visitors as well......Many fruit flies invaded their home. The grandkids went to the garden to pick veggies and fruit with Mems and Pops, but they also brought back some new family members with them. We tried so hard to get rid of them. Every morning it seemed as if they multiplied while we were sleeping. So we got on the Internet to find a quick fix.....Below are our attempts. It really became very funny as the week progressed because each day we introduced a new trap!

Our first trap.....syrup and honey on a plate....did not work!!
Uncle Brett's Trap
Fruit in baggie with hole.....
Did not work
Internet trap.... Bottle with funnel and tomato
WORKED!!!! Took several days to catch them, but it was success!

Sunday Lunch

I have sweet memories of Sunday lunch as a child. Sunday lunch meant lunch after church at Mamaw and Papaw's house where we ate either roast, pork tenderloin, or chicken and dressing with a side of butter beans or Mamaw's famous carrots (my favorite!!) and of course hot rolls. Left over rolls meant dinner for after Sunday night church- roast sandwiches. If there was extra rolls, then my little brother and I could have 2 of them to play our own game of communion in Mamaw's living room after lunch! Sunday lunch is also where I learned the art of setting a table for a big family meal and where I learned to make peach cobbler. Sunday lunch holds so many sweet memories for me filled with wonderful smells of Mamaw's kitchen. Today I took a few pictures of my own family at Sunday lunch.
